How much does it cost to rent an apartment in North Palm Beach?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| North Palm Beach Studio Apartments with Swimming Pool | $1,600 | $1,600 | $1,600 |
| North Palm Beach 1 Bedroom Apartments with Swimming Pool | $2,525 | $1,550 | $5,011 |
| North Palm Beach 2 Bedroom Apartments with Swimming Pool | $3,200 | $1,800 | $10,000+ |
| North Palm Beach 3 Bedroom Apartments with Swimming Pool | $3,203 | $1,950 | $7,303 |
| North Palm Beach 4 Bedroom Apartments with Swimming Pool | $7,064 | $3,200 | $9,063 |

Frequently Asked Questions about North Palm Beach Apartments with Swimming Pool
How much is the average rent for North Palm Beach Apartments with Swimming Pool?
The average rent for a Apartment in North Palm Beach with Swimming Pool is $3,045.
What is the largest North Palm Beach Apartment for rent with Swimming Pool?
Today's Apartment with Swimming Pool and the most square footage in North Palm Beach is a 1,907 square feet unit starting from $2,826 at Villas of Juno.
What is the average size for North Palm Beach Apartments for rent with Swimming Pool?
The average size for a rental with Swimming Pool in North Palm Beach is currently at 818 sq ft.
